**Onboarding: Cold Starts — Quillfont Handlers**

Serverless handlers on the Quillfont platform cold-start in 1–3s. We pre-warm via scheduled pings from Heatline. Security-relevant: warm pools retain decrypted config in memory for up to ten minutes. Audit scope covers the Heatline scheduler and its access path. Heatline authenticates to the internal config API with the key below.

API key for fahip-kahip: zpat23_XiJGUHz5xfaAtaIqUkus0rh

Confirm lockout via the auth audit view, then halt the shard rebuild scheduler to avoid partial writes. Recovery requires release-manager authority: open the Tillbrook operator console, select the indexer account, and choose passphrase-based recovery. After unlock, restart the scheduler and verify suggestion latency returns under threshold before approving the release. Enter the recovery passphrase given below.

unlock words, hahip-baduf: holwyn-istath-julvan

Subject: Chip reader firmware — race-day fix out

Team,

The Striderline mat readers were dropping reads above 40 crossings/sec, which bit us at the Hallowmere half-marathon rehearsal. Firmware 2.7 raises the antenna polling rate and dedupes within a 200ms window instead of 500ms. Bench tests show zero misses at 60 crossings/sec. Field units get flashed Thursday; spares stay on 2.6 until Saturday's dry run passes. No protocol changes, so the timing backend is untouched. Flash images are signed against the build below.

pipeline stamp: htk9_6ce9d33c5

Subject: Cron drift cut-over complete

Welcome aboard, all. Quick summary: the scheduler on Pellwick had drifted because its host clock synced against a decommissioned time source, so nightly jobs slid by several minutes per week. We cut over to the managed scheduler on Torbay cluster last night and verified three clean runs. The scheduler now runs with the following configuration values.

service settings:
[druvan]
port = 3306
region = central-4
host = druvan.braskdata.local
team = kelax
timeout_ms = 1000
retries = 2